Som besökare på Hamsterpaj samtycker du till användandet av s.k. cookies för att förbättra din upplevelse hos oss. Jag förstår, ta bort denna ruta!
Annons

Select distinct

Skapad av Borttagen, 2010-12-26 02:41 i Webbutveckling & Programmering

876
8 inlägg
0 poäng
openoffice
Visningsbild
Hjälte 117 inlägg
0
Jag håller på med en grej på min sida som ska visa senaste foruminläggen, exakt som här på hamsterpaj. Jag använd SELECT DISTINCT threadid FROM `forum_answer` ORDER BY `id` DESC LIMIT 8
där thereadid är sidan title som hämtas från en annan tabell.
Jag vill alltså först välja de 8 unika thereadid som har de högsta id (alltså nyast) från tabellen forum_answer.
Problemet är att den inte väljen de senaste när jag använder DISTINCT.
Hur ska man lösa detta enklast?

tacksam för tips!

Ingen status

Är reklamen ivägen? Logga in eller registrera dig så försvinner den!

Klas-Kenny
Visningsbild
P 31 Växjö Hjälte 12 128 inlägg
0
Varför ska du ens använda distinct?

Rätt verktyg till rätt arbete - Makaroner äts med sked.

openoffice
Visningsbild
Hjälte 117 inlägg
Trådskapare
0

Svar till Klas-Kenny [Gå till post]:
jag tänkte använda det för att samma tråd inte ska upprepas, utan de ska vara de senaste 8 unika

Ingen status

pr0n
Visningsbild
P Hjälte 5 588 inlägg
0

Svar till openoffice [Gå till post]:
Blir det bättre om du tar bort ' ' runt id?

alltså
ORDER BY id
istället för
ORDER BY 'id'

.. ibland bråkar det och tror att det ska vara strängar istället, så den sorterar lite puckat :/ har hänt för mig nån gång

Ingen status

pr0n
Visningsbild
P Hjälte 5 588 inlägg
0

Svar till openoffice [Gå till post]:
Fast.. du gör väl inte flera kopior av en tråd? Då ska du ju inte behöva använda distinct :/

Ingen status

openoffice
Visningsbild
Hjälte 117 inlägg
Trådskapare
0

Svar till pr0n [Gå till post]:
funkade inte :/

Ingen status

openoffice
Visningsbild
Hjälte 117 inlägg
Trådskapare
0

Svar till pr0n [Gå till post]:
nej men detta är till för senaste inläggen, och då kan de ju hämda att två personer skriver eftervarandra i samma tråd. Då vill jag bara att den ska synas 1 gång

Ingen status

openoffice
Visningsbild
Hjälte 117 inlägg
Trådskapare
0
är det någon som vet ?

Ingen status


Forum » Datorer & IT » Webbutveckling & Programmering » Select distinct

Ansvariga ordningsvakter:

Användare som läser i den här tråden just nu

1 utloggad

Skriv ett nytt inlägg

Hej! Innan du skriver om ett potentiellt problem så vill vi påminna dig om att du faktiskt inte är ensam. Du är inte onormal och världen kommer inte att gå under, vi lovar! Så slappna av och gilla livet i några minuter - känns det fortfarande hemskt? Skriv gärna ner dina tankar och frågor, vi älskar att hjälpa just dig!

Den här tråden är äldre än Rojks drömtjej!

Det senaste inlägget i den här tråden skrevs för över tre månader sedan. Är du säker på att du vill återuppliva diskussionen? Har du något vettigt att tillföra eller passar din fråga i en ny tråd? Onödiga återupplivningar kommer att låsas så tänk efter en extra gång!

Hjälp

Det här är en hjälpruta

Här får du korta tips och förklaringar om forumet. Välj kapitel i rullningslisten här ovanför.

Rutan uppdateras automagiskt

När du använder funktioner i forumet så visas bra tips här.


Annons
Annons
Annons
Annons